Hinshaw & Culbertson LLP is a national law firm with a strong presence in California, offering a collaborative environment for attorneys. They are seeking a mid-level associate attorney specializing in professional malpractice litigation to handle complex cases and contribute to the firm's commitment to excellence.


Responsibilities

  • Represent clients in professional malpractice litigation, including handling claims against attorneys and law firms as well as defending malpractice suits
  • Conduct thorough investigations and case evaluations, including reviewing legal documents, case files, and related evidence
  • Draft and respond to pleadings, motions, discovery requests, and other legal documents
  • Negotiate settlements and alternative dispute resolutions with opposing counsel
  • Manage all phases of litigation, including depositions, hearings, trials, and appeals
  • Provide legal advice and counsel to clients regarding potential malpractice claims and risk management strategies
  • Collaborate with experts and consultants to analyze claims and build case strategies
  • Maintain up-to-date knowledge of legal malpractice law, court rules, and procedural requirements
  • Supervise and mentor junior attorneys and legal staff
  • Develop and maintain strong client relationships and communicate case developments effectively

Skills

  • Juris Doctor (JD) degree from an accredited law school
  • Admission to the California State Bar and in good standing
  • 3+ years of experience specifically in professional malpractice litigation or related areas such as professional liability or legal ethics
  • Proven track record handling professional malpractice cases, including trial experience
  • Strong research, writing, and oral advocacy skills
  • Ability to manage multiple cases and deadlines effectively
  • High level of professionalism, ethics, and client service orientation
  • Strong interpersonal skills and ability to work collaboratively within a team
